Picture number 25328 25328 2055 K Staff Beresford Square In service as a Central Repair Depot staff car 2055 is disgourging its passengers at the end of the working day.
This car was one of the 2nd series K's nicknamed 'Rockets' as they were reputedly the fastest cars in the LPTB fleet. It retained its original Brush windscreen at this end. 2055 was scrappped in July 1952.
